ArmInfo. The new Ambassador of the Republic of Armenia to the Russian Federation Gurgen Arsenyan announced the termination of the powers of the Chairman of the United Labor Party, which he created. He reported this on social media.
Arsenyan recalled that by the decree of the President of the Republic, at the suggestion of the Prime Minister, on August 14, I was appointed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of Armenia to Russia. In this regard, he resigned from his mandate as a member of the National Assembly, and also terminated the powers of the Chairman of the United Labor Party (ULP) and his membership in the party.
